Community Services District to Consider Connection Fee Increases for Sewer, Water and Commercial Disposal Service; CSD’s Board of Directors Meets This Evening
Though the Board of Directors of the Big Bear City Community Services District has held the line in terms of rate increases for customers within their service area, the Board will consider an increase to new connection fees. The introduction of ordinances addressing connection fee increases for water, sewer and commercial disposal service will be made at this evening’s meeting of CSD, to be held at their offices at 139 E. Big Bear Boulevard at 5:30pm.
